| | Re: Help w/ Printing Properties In article <8E303444-5B25-4A6C-86B8-02FDB76C5F19@microsoft.com>, Fr3Sh wrote: > "Hugh Wyn Griffith" wrote: No that was Cari who posted that. > so theres no print properties because I upgraded from xp to vista? Well Yes and No <g> The basic reason may be because to get VISTA out on the streets HP provided to Microsoft a very basic driver for some of its printers to be included in VISTA with a view to providing fully featured software later. But "Yes", if you had not gone to VISTA you would not have had the problem if the fully featured driver was available for your printer and version of Windows. |
